Almedia

Backend Engineer

Berlin
Python FastAPI Pydantic MongoDB BigQuery Memcached Docker GitHub Actions PM2 Hetzner Next.js React TypeScript Google Cloud Platform PostgreSQL Redis API SQL
Description

Backend Engineer (Node.Js & FastAPI)

Department: Tech

Location: Berlin

Compensation: €60K – €100K • Offers Equity • Offers Bonus

Employment Type: FullTime

This isn’t your regular job. Almedia is a place where those who want to push harder can accelerate their careers faster than anywhere else. We’re aiming to become Germany’s second bootstrapped unicorn. Almedia is already Europe’s #3 fastest-growing company in 2025 (FT1000).

We are building the future of marketing by rewarding our community of over 70 million users for engaging with our advertisers’ products. We are offering a new way to acquire users for the biggest companies in the world.

We’re looking for a Backend Engineer to co-own and scale our Client Platform - the internal system powering offer, game, and budget management across our ad network products.

If you like owning backend systems end-to-end, shipping fast, and improving infrastructure while building real product features, let’s talk.

Tech Stack 💻

  • Backend: TypeScript, Node.js, Python, FastAPI (Pydantic).

  • MongoDB, BigQuery, PostgreSQL.

  • Kubernetes, Docker, GitHub Actions.

  • Google Cloud Platform.

  • Frontend: TypeScript, Next.Js, React.

What You’ll Do 🎯

  • Own and extend our Client Platforms Node.JS & FastAPI backend (routers, services, data layer).

  • Build end-to-end features from data layer, backend and frontend.

  • Maintain strict typing between backend and frontend.

  • Build and optimize our Database layer/access (+ WCaching with Memcached/Redis, Working with DBT).

  • Integrate internal services & third-party platforms (HubSpot, Slack) via API.

  • Improve CI/CD (GitHub Actions), Docker-based deployments (Hetzner / PM2), staging environment, build/expand our testing suite, and own observability.

What You’ll Bring 💡

  • Strong TypeScript (Node.Js Frameworks such as NestJS) and Python experience (FastAPI or similar async frameworks).

  • Solid API design and data modeling skills.

  • Hands-on experience with MongoDB and PostgreSQL (or comparable).

  • Experience with BigQuery or similar analytics systems.

  • Comfortable owning features from idea to production.

What Makes You a Great Fit 🌟

  • Ownership-driven and pragmatic.

  • Product-minded with a strong quality bar.

  • Comfortable in a fast-moving environment.

  • Clear communicator in English.

Why Almedia? 🎁

  • Own Our Growth: We offer all Berlin-based employees equity in Almedia to truly be a part of our success.

  • Scale With Almedia: Grow alongside a startup that has been profitable from day one.

  • Central Berlin Office: Work from a fully-stocked modern office built for collaboration, accessible from all around Berlin.

  • Other Benefits: Transport subsidy, breakfasts and lunches, language learning, Urban Sports Club, and more.

We believe in fostering talent, evaluating all skill levels during the hiring process, and providing a clear path for growth. Almedia is an equal opportunity employer. We embrace and celebrate diversity, and encourage individuals from all backgrounds to apply.

Almedia
Almedia

0 applies

0 views

There are more than 50,000 engineering jobs:

Subscribe to membership and unlock all jobs

Engineering Jobs

60,000+ jobs from 4,500+ well-funded companies

Updated Daily

New jobs are added every day as companies post them

Refined Search

Use filters like skill, location, etc to narrow results

Become a member

🥳🥳🥳 452 happy customers and counting...

Overall, over 80% of customers chose to renew their subscriptions after the initial sign-up.

To try it out

For active job seekers

For those who are passive looking

Cancel anytime

Frequently Asked Questions

  • We prioritize job seekers as our customers, unlike bigger job sites, by charging a small fee to provide them with curated access to the best companies and up-to-date jobs. This focus allows us to deliver a more personalized and effective job search experience.
  • We've got over 200,000 jobs from 15,000+ vetted companies. No fake or sleazy jobs here!
  • We aggregate jobs from 15,000+ companies' career pages, so you can be sure that you're getting the most up-to-date and relevant jobs.
  • We're the only job board *for* software engineers, *by* software engineers… in case you needed a reminder! We add thousands of new jobs daily and offer powerful search filters just for you. 🛠️
  • Every single hour! We add 2,000-3,000 new jobs daily, so you'll always have fresh opportunities. 🚀
  • Typically, job searches take 3-6 months. EchoJobs helps you spend more time applying and less time hunting. 🎯
  • Check daily! We're always updating with new jobs. Set up job alerts for even quicker access. 📅

What Fellow Engineers Say